Output 193bf3879d5b04f94b0e24b15dfb612f24ae499f91c726042e9f4b572207e9a1:55

value
174483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15757432df7ecbab1e7bff5ce3aac3b404b22521 OP_EQUAL
address
33eUpQsJW8B57mVF2e88anUjA771LHHmRt
transaction
193bf3879d5b04f94b0e24b15dfb612f24ae499f91c726042e9f4b572207e9a1
confirmations
203122
spent
true